	Improve performance of zio_taskq_member
__zio_execute() calls zio_taskq_member() to determine if we are running in a zio interrupt taskq, in which case we may need to switch to processing this zio in a zio issue taskq. The call to zio_taskq_member() can become a performance bottleneck when we are processing a high rate of zio's. zio_taskq_member() calls taskq_member() on each of the zio interrupt taskqs, of which there are 21. This is slow because each call to taskq_member() does tsd_get(taskq_tsd), which on Linux is relatively slow. This commit improves the performance of zio_taskq_member() by having it cache the value of tsd_get(taskq_tsd), reducing the number of those calls to 1/21th of the current behavior. In a test case running `zfs send -c >/dev/null` of a filesystem with small blocks (average 2.5KB/block), zio_taskq_member() was using 6.7% of one CPU, and with this change it is reduced to 1.3%. Overall time to perform the `zfs send` reduced by 10% (~150,000 block/sec to ~165,000 blocks/sec).
